Drainage holes come with each of these window flower boxes to avoid root rot. Plus, they come with cleat mounting systems to hang directly under your windows. They can be ordered with or without the liner, although liners are recommended to extend the life of your window boxes and further resist rotting. Common herbs can be easily grown in unfinished cedar window planters.
Herbs and garden vegetable recommendations include: Asian Greens, Basil, Bush Beans, Chervil, Chives, Cilantro, Dill, Garlic, Lettuce, Mint, Nasturtium, Onion, Oregano, Peas, Pole Beans, Radish, Round Carrots, Shallots, Runner Bean, Spinach, Strawberries, Thyme, and Globe Zucchini.
To Finish or Not to Finish
Many customers love to keep the natural look of the unfinished Framed Cottage Cedar Window Box. One reason other individuals choose the natural wood is because it is an optimal environment for growing plants, especially edible plants. Still others just prefer the rustic look of unfinished wood, fragrant, warm, and inviting. Still, the case for painting your cedar window box, staining or otherwise sealing it with a polyurethane seal is to add a layer to weatherproof it, which extends the life of your planter. Regardless of how you might choose to finish your wooden window planter, or if you keep it natural and unfinished, it will look beautiful and warm for years to come.
